> The root of your problem is that your tool is deleting files without
> telling SVN that the file is deleted. That is why an update restores
> the files.

But that's not an argument against having the delete option in the
"check for modifications" dialog. The fact is, that there are a lot of
tools that are not subversion-aware, and the tools are used on
subversion wc's, and they leave users like me and Andrey with the
problem of missing files. Therefore, the option should be available in
TSVN "check for modifications" dialog.
